About Pamela A. Harvey
Pamela Harvey is a neuroscientist, professor, and freelance medical writer with 20 years of experience in science communications. She has a doctorate in neuroscience and postdoctoral training in molecular biology. Dr. Harvey has conducted research and published in the fields of neuroscience, cardiology, and immunology. As a lifelong learner and educator, she is passionate about making science relatable and understandable to everyone.
